I took you along on a very cosy little 2-day London trip—think quick city landscapes, a peek inside my sketchbook, and a slow wander through Choosing Keeping (which honestly feels like a stationery hug). I share the bits I managed to paint while travelling, what I reached for in my kit, and how I approached making pages when time is limited and you’re out and about. It’s a gentle reminder that a “successful” trip sketchbook doesn’t have to be packed—sometimes a few small studies and notes are exactly enough. Later, I do a proper art haul and show you what I brought home (including stickers and some lovely bits that will definitely end up in my journaling). I also share a tiny sneak peek of a half-day solo outing to St. Mawgan in Cornwall, because I love balancing busy travel with quiet, local moments.
